The Plantagenet Dynasty, ruling from 1154 to 1485, profoundly influenced medieval England and legal systems worldwide. Originating with Henry II, the dynasty oversaw the creation of the Magna Carta, faced the Hundred Years' War, and experienced the Wars of the Roses, which led to their fall and the rise of the Tudors. Their legacy includes significant legal reforms and the establishment of principles that underpin modern democracy.
